On 06/05/12 01:42, Albert Wagner wrote:
> In Xubuntu 12.04 there is no detection of my printer, nor is there a
> list of printers to choose from when adding a printer. It just
> requests a device URI, such as ipp://cups-server/printers/printer-queue.
> This seems pretty primitive. I suspect something needs to be done
> more useful than trying to find a URI for my printer: Epson WP-4020.
> Xubuntu 11.10 had no problem detecting, finding the correct driver,
> and installing. What can be done in 12.04?
>
Is cups installed?
I had a problem with 12.04 (in a VBox installation) where, although it
could see my Epson DX4000 printer, it wouldn't print until I installed
cups-driver-gutenprint from Synaptic.
